Job Summary Lead Culinary Excellence at a Premier University Dining ProgramAre you a passionate culinary leader who thrives in high-volume environments and enjoys creating exceptional dining experiences? Binghamton University is seeking an experienced Catering Executive Chef to oversee catering and culinary operations, lead a talented team, and deliver innovative, high-quality food experiences for students, faculty, staff, and guests.
This is an outstanding opportunity for a hands‑on chef with strong leadership skills, entrepreneurial spirit, and a commitment to culinary excellence.
As the Catering Executive Chef, you will:- Lead all catering and kitchen operations, ensuring exceptional food quality and presentation
- Develop and execute regular and specialty menus for a wide variety of events and functions
- Train, mentor, and develop culinary team members while fostering a positive kitchen culture
- Ensure adherence to food safety, sanitation, and regulatory compliance standards
- Manage food purchasing, inventory, production planning, and cost controls
- Monitor labor utilization and kitchen productivity to drive operational excellence
- Maintain equipment, storage, and work areas in accordance with company and health department standards
- Oversee production schedules, waste management initiatives, and quality assurance programs
- Partner with campus stakeholders to create memorable and innovative catering experiences
- Support client satisfaction initiatives and continuously elevate the guest experience
- 5+ years of progressive culinary leadership experience
- Executive Chef, Chef Manager, Senior Sous Chef, or Catering Chef background preferred
- Extensive catering experience highly desirable
- Experience in high-volume, complex food service environments
- Strong leadership and team development skills
- Hands‑on culinary expertise with strong execution capabilities
- Knowledge of food trends, menu development, and presentation standards
- Experience with food cost management, inventory control, and purchasing
- Institutional, university, hospitality, healthcare, or contract food service experience preferred
- Proficiency with Microsoft Office Suite and business technology tools
- Serv Safe Certification preferred
- Associate degree in Culinary Arts or equivalent experience preferred
